Etihad Airways is expanding its flights to Thiruvananthapuram and Kozhikode

The national airline of the United Arab Emirates, Etihad Airways, has launched two new services to mark the start of 2024. Daily flights from Abu Dhabi to Kozhikode (CCJ) and Thiruvananthapuram (TRV) in Kerala, India, began on New Year’s Day.

These nonstop flights to each destination strengthen Etihad’s footprint in India, bringing the total number of cities served to ten. This development is part of the airline’s efforts to make its worldwide network more accessible to travellers from the Subcontinent. “We have established an outstanding collection of non-stop routes between India and Abu Dhabi, providing customers with easier access to our growing network without having to pass through one of the main Indian hub airports,” stated Etihad CEO Antonoaldo Neves.

Etihad Airways Allocates Unutilized Seats

Despite its significant operations, Etihad Airways claims it has not met the maximum amount of its bilateral weekly seat allocation from and to India. Out of the 50,000 available seats, the airline only uses 40,000, which means 10,000 seats are left empty each week. This emphasises the airline’s unused potential for future growth, as well as its versatility in responding to market demands.
